Ingredients:

  • 3 green peppers
  • 1 tomatoes
  • 2 cups water
  • 1 cup vinegar
  • 1 cup brown sugar
  • 1 cup soy sauce
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 4 potatoes
  • 2 onions
  • 1 garlic bulb
  • 1 red chili pepper
  • 1 tablespoon cayenne pepper
  • 2 teaspoons Tabasco sauce
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ions:

Step Description Time
1 Cut potatoes into small chunks and boil for 4-5 minutes until slightly cooked. Drain and rinse with cold water. 5 minutes
2 Heat frying oil to 160°C and fry potatoes for 5-6 minutes until cooked but not crispy. Then fry until golden and crunchy at 190°C. 10-12 minutes
3 In a deep skillet or wok, heat olive oil. Fry onions until wilted, then add garlic and chili pepper. 5 minutes
4 Add green peppers and spices. Experiment with the spice levels according to preference. 3 minutes
5 Mix water, soy sauce, vinegar, and sugar. Stir into the skillet and reduce until thick and gooey. 5 minutes
6 Cut tomatoes into eighths and add to the mixture. 2 minutes
7 Just before serving, toss the potatoes in the mixture. 2 minutes
